Barefoot Sound is known for its innovative design, expert craftsmanship, and class-leading performance. Founded in 2006 by scientist, engineer, and inventor Thomas Barefoot, the brand has quickly become one of the leading high-performance studio monitor manufacturers.

While developing semiconductor manufacturing technology for Intel in the early 2000s, Thomas spent his spare time pursuing his passion for music. He quickly became known as a speaker and acoustics guru in online recording forums, and often shared his belief that every step of the production process requires the same level of sound quality, dynamic range, and bass extension.

In 2004, Thomas designed a groundbreaking all-in-one approach to monitoring that utilizes multiple drivers to deliver balanced, detailed sound across the entire frequency spectrum in any environment. Today, Barefoot studio monitors are used in recording studios all around the world by everyone from GRAMMY-winning engineers like Butch Vig, Chris Lord-Alge, Eddie Kramer, and Jack Joseph Puig, to world-class performing artists such as Dave Grohl, Lady Gaga, Jay-Z, and more.

MEME Technology

No, not that kind of meme… MEME (Multi-Emphasis Monitor Emulation) technology uses sophisticated DSP modeling to emulate the sound of a wide range of classic studio speakers, giving you the flexibility to A/B your tracks on multiple sets of speakers, all from the same device.

The “Old School” setting captures the sound of the iconic Yamaha NS10M monitors, with a strong midrange presence. The “Cube” setting is modeled after Auratone cubes. “Hi-Fi” sweetens the high-end and warms the mid-range, similar to consumer hi-fi systems.

Dual-Force Technology

Traditional studio monitors suffer from distortion and coloration caused by the driver vibrating back and forth. Barefoot Sound studio monitors utilize an innovative force cancellation design that eliminates cabinet vibrations before they even begin for distortion-free sound, even with extremely low frequencies.

Barefoot Sound Dual-Ring Radiator Tweeter

Dual-Ring Radiator Tweeter

Unlike conventional tweeters, which have very narrow dispersion, Barefoot Sound studio monitors feature dual-ring radiator technology, which provides an extremely wide sweet spot all the way up to 40 kHz. With a wide sweet spot, you can rest assured that your mixes will sound the same in any listening position.

Footprint Series

In October 2025, Barefoot Sound introduced the Footprint01 Gen2 and Footprint02 Gen2 studio monitors, featuring a tri-amplified architecture, new drivers, advanced DSP with SPOC technology, and a refined cabinet design.

Footprint01 Gen2

Footprint01 Gen2

In addition to the new features listed above, the Footprint01 Gen2 studio monitors are equipped with a 1-inch dual-ring radiator tweeter with a rear waveguide chamber, a 5-inch aluminum cone midrange driver, and dual 8-inch aluminum cone woofers—all with high magnetic flux motors.

Thanks to its new tri-amplified design, the Footprint01 Gen2 monitors feature powerful Class D amplifiers: 60W for the tweeter, 150W for the midrange driver, and 500W for the woofers.

Footprint02 Gen2

Footprint02 Gen2

Much like the Footprint01 Gen2 studio monitors, the Footprint02 Gen2s feature the same new drivers, the only difference are the smaller 6.5-inch woofers. The Footprint02 Gen2s use a 60W amplifier for the tweeter, adn two 200W amps for the midrange and low-end drivers.

 

Footprint03

The Footprint03 is the smallest and most affordable option in the series, making it ideal for smaller studios. It's also the first Footprint monitor to feature tri-amplification, as the tweeter, midrange, and woofer are all powered by individual Class D amplifier modules. In addition, this is the first ported cabinet from Barefoot Sound, which helps extend the low-end and add clarity to playback.

Under the hood, the Footprint03 introduces SPOC (Spectrally Optimized Conversion), a groundbreaking technology developed by Barefoot Sound. SPOC incorporates a crossover section before analog-to-digital conversion, allowing high frequencies to pass into the converter unattenuated. This results in higher audio resolution and a more transparent signal, unparalleled in its class. Barefoot Sound has also updated its DSP for the Footprint03, and includes its patented MEME technology for a number of different monitor voicings.

MicroMain26

Based on the renowned MicroMain27 Gen2, the Barefoot Sound MicroMain26 is a 4-way active speaker system that features six drivers for a transparent, detailed sound. A 1-inch tweeter delivers incredible detail and wide dispersion for an extended sweet spot. The 2.5-inch aluminum cone midrange is housed in a cutting-edge 3D-printed waveguide enclosure to help prevent distortion. Equipped with two 5.25-inch paper cone woofers and two 10-inch aluminum cone subwoofers, MicroMain26 monitors deliver class-leading low-end.

As a 4-way system, each driver is powered by its own state-of-the-art Hypex amplifier for maximum clarity, even at high volumes. The tweeter and midrange drivers are both powered by their own 180 W amps, while the woofers have a dedicated 250 W amp. The subwoofers are powered by a massive 500 W amplifier for maximum low-end efficiency.

Barefoot Sound MicroMain27 Gen2 studio monitor

MicroMain27 Gen2

The monitor that put Barefoot Sound on the map. Released in 2006, the Barefoot Sound MicroMain27 Gen2 is a 3.5-way active system with five drivers for an extended frequency response from 30 Hz to 45 kHz. A 1-inch ring radiator tweeter provides crystal clear highs. Two 5.25-inch paper cone midbass drivers offer unparalleled detail, while two 10-inch aluminum cone subwoofers deliver tight, punchy bass. Barefoot Sound teamed up with Bruno Putzeys of Hypex to develop a completely transparent amplifier stage with 1,250 W of total power.

The MicroMain27 Gen2 is the most versatile reference monitor in the Barefoot Sound catalog and works well in studios and production facilities of all sizes.

MicroMain45

The MicroMain45 is a stripped-down version of the MiniMain12 with a compact footprint and an affordable price tag. This 3-way active reference monitor features four drivers: a 1-inch tweeter, two 2.5-inch midrange woofers, and an 8-inch woofer.

The MicroMain45 utilizes a zero-compromise design to capture the signature Barefoot Sound. With an extended frequency response from 40 Hz – 45 kHz the MicroMain45 delivers class-leading sound quality. As the most compact Barefoot monitor, the MicroMain45 is ideal for smaller studios, and with over 600 W of power, it delivers distortion-free sound even at high levels.

Barefoot Sound MicroSub45 subwoofer

MicroSub45

The MicroSub45 is designed specifically to complement the MicroMain45. The MicroSub45 adds depth, power, and headroom to your system with dual 8-inch aluminum cone drivers and 500 W of power. The MicroSub45 also utilizes Barefoot Sound’s signature dual-force technology for an extended frequency response down to 25 Hz.

Barefoot Sound MicroStack45 studio monitor and subwoofer

MicroStack45

The MicroStack45 combines a pair of 3-way active MicroMain45 reference monitors and stereo MicroSub45 subwoofers for a total of six 8-inch aluminum woofers, four 2.5-inch midrange drivers, and a pair of 1-inch tweeters, all designed to work together seamlessly. And with 2220 W of power, this compact speaker system is perfect for small to mid-sized studios. An innovative tilt feature enables you to perfectly position the MicroMain45 monitors towards your sweet spot.

MiniMain12

The MiniMain12 is based on Thomas Barefoot’s original design from 2004 and takes the signature Barefoot sound to a whole new level of resolution and detail. The MiniMain12 is a 4-way active speaker system with seven drivers for unprecedented clarity throughout the entire frequency spectrum.

A 1-inch tweeter delivers pristine highs. Dual 2.5-inch aluminum midrange drivers produce punchy, focused mids, while two 7-inch woofers offer thick, rich lows. Two 12-inch subwoofers provide powerful low-end. Each driver is powered by its own Hypex amplifier and operates as a perfect piston for ultra-fast transient response.

As the largest all-in-one speaker in the Barefoot lineup, the MiniMain12 is perfect for mid to large-sized studios that need plenty of power.

Barefoot Sound MasterStack12 studio monitor

MasterStack12

The MasterStack12 is the pinnacle of Thomas Barefoot’s achievements in monitor speaker design. This astonishing monitor system, which features MiniMain 12 and MiniSub12, combines Barefoot Sound’s signature sound with breathtaking dynamic range and advanced DSP technology for unrivaled performance.

The MasterStack12 is a 4.5-way active modular tower with 10 drivers housed in two cabinets. A third base unit provides signal and power distribution. A 1-inch ring radiator tweeter powered by a 250 W amplifier delivers crystal-clear high-end, while two 2.5-inch midrange drivers with their own 250 W amps deliver clear, detailed mids.

The true charm of the MasterStack12 is in the woofers. All three woofers operate down to 80 Hz, but only two of the woofers extend up to the mid-range band crossover point. With three woofers working together in the low-mid frequencies, the MasterStack12 produces minimal distortion. And with four dedicated 12-inch subwoofers, the MasterStack12 offers massive bass response.

This massive multi-speaker system is ideal for large-scale studios and post-production facilities.
